Introduction

The 865 area code is the telephone code of East Tennessee, anchored by Knoxville where the Tennessee River winds down out of the Appalachian foothills.

It rings across a distinctive stretch of the state: the university city of Knoxville itself, the science town of Oak Ridge, the aluminum town of Alcoa and the resort towns of Gatlinburg, Pigeon Forge and Sevierville that serve as the northern gateway to Great Smoky Mountains National Park.

A number that begins with 865 sits firmly in the eastern end of Tennessee, in the Eastern Time band that separates this corner of the state from Nashville and Memphis further west.

The 865 code is also unusual for a reason that has nothing to do with geography: it was picked for what it spells. Dial 8-6-5 on a standard keypad and the letters read V-O-L — short for Volunteer, the nickname of the University of Tennessee and the whole state.

What Is the 865 Area Code?

The 865 area code is a telephone area code serving the eastern portion of Tennessee, centered on the Knoxville metropolitan area and the surrounding counties of the Great Valley of East Tennessee. It was created in 1999 when the older 423 code, which had covered the entire eastern third of the state, was split to add a fresh supply of numbers for the fast-growing Knoxville region.

Unlike many modern codes, 865 is a standalone code with no overlay laid on top of it, so East Tennessee still enjoys straightforward single-code dialing within the 865 territory.

Dialing Format and Time Zone

  • Dialing format: (865) 555-0157
  • International: +1 865-555-0157
  • Time zone: Eastern Time (ET) — UTC−5 in winter, UTC−4 during Daylight Saving (mid-March to early November)
  • Keypad spelling: 8-6-5 reads as VOL, for the Tennessee Volunteers — the reason the code was chosen

Where Is the 865 Area Code? Cities & Communities

Geographically, 865 covers a compact cluster of counties in the eastern end of Tennessee, tucked into the Great Valley between the Cumberland Plateau to the west and the Great Smoky Mountains to the southeast. Knoxville is the hub, and the code radiates out to the university, laboratory and resort towns that ring it. This is a smaller footprint than many metro codes, reflecting the 1999 decision to carve a dedicated Knoxville-area code out of the much larger 423 region.

865 coverage — East Tennessee around Knoxville, from Oak Ridge and Maryville to the Great Smoky Mountains gateway at Gatlinburg and Pigeon Forge

Major Cities and Communities

  • Knoxville — East Tennessee's largest city, home to the University of Tennessee and the Tennessee Valley Authority headquarters
  • Oak Ridge — the 'Secret City' of the Manhattan Project, still a national center for energy and nuclear science
  • Maryville & Alcoa — the Blount County twin cities south of Knoxville, anchored by aluminum manufacturing and the McGhee Tyson airport
  • Sevierville, Pigeon Forge & Gatlinburg — the Sevier County resort corridor and northern gateway to Great Smoky Mountains National Park
  • Morristown — the manufacturing and agricultural hub of Hamblen County to the northeast
  • Farragut — an affluent town on the west side of the Knoxville metro along the Tennessee River
  • Clinton & Anderson County — the northern edge of the region toward the Cumberlands

Beyond the 865 region, the neighboring codes take over quickly. The rest of East Tennessee — Chattanooga to the south and the Tri-Cities of Kingsport, Johnson City and Bristol to the northeast — kept the original 423 code after the split. Across the state, Middle Tennessee runs on the 615 area code around Nashville, and West Tennessee on 901 around Memphis.

A driver heading out of Knoxville in almost any direction crosses into different numbering territory within an hour or two.

865 Time Zone

The entire 865 region observes Eastern Time (ET) — UTC−5 during Eastern Standard Time in the fall and winter, and UTC−4 during Eastern Daylight Time from mid-March through early November. This is one of the details that sets East Tennessee apart from the rest of the state: while Knoxville keeps Eastern Time, Nashville and Memphis to the west sit in the Central Time zone, so there is a one-hour gap between the two ends of Tennessee.

For businesses, the Eastern Time placement is an advantage. An 865 number shares its clock with the major East Coast markets from Atlanta to New York, so a Knoxville line answers in step with the bulk of the country's business hours. How 865 Split From 423: The Code That Spells VOL

For most of the twentieth century, the eastern third of Tennessee shared a single area code. The whole state used 615 until 1995, when 423 was split off to serve East Tennessee. By the late 1990s the growth in mobile phones, fax lines and pagers was draining the supply of 423 numbers around booming Knoxville, and regulators had to add relief.

865 spells VOL on the keypad — 8-6-5 maps to V-O-L for the Tennessee Volunteers, the reason Knoxville took the new code split from 423 in 1999

On November 1, 1999, the 865 code went into service for the Knoxville area, with permissive dialing of the old 423 code continuing until April 24, 2000.

  • 423 — the 1995 East Tennessee code, retained for Chattanooga and the Tri-Cities after the split
  • 865 — carved out for the Knoxville metro on November 1, 1999, as a geographic split rather than an overlay
  • VOL — the letters 8-6-5 spell on the keypad, chosen deliberately for the University of Tennessee Volunteers

Two things made the 865 split distinctive. First, regulators chose a geographic split over an overlay — overlays were new and controversial at the time because they forced ten-digit dialing, so East Tennessee kept the simpler single-code approach for each region.

Second, in an unusual twist, the established metro took the new number: normally the biggest city keeps the existing code, but here Knoxville accepted the fresh 865 code specifically so it could spell VOL. It remains one of the clearest examples of a community choosing an area code for its meaning, turning a routine numbering change into a point of local pride.

Knoxville, Oak Ridge and the Smokies: the 865 Economy

An 865 number connects a business to one of the most varied regional economies in the South — a blend of higher education, big science, advanced manufacturing and one of the busiest tourism corridors in the country. Because 865 has no overlay, a single code covers all of it, from a downtown Knoxville office to a laboratory campus in Oak Ridge to a storefront on the Parkway in Pigeon Forge.

East Tennessee economy — the University of Tennessee and TVA in Knoxville, big science at Oak Ridge, aluminum in Alcoa, and Smoky Mountain tourism

University, Energy and Big Science

Knoxville is a university and energy town at heart. The University of Tennessee anchors the city, while the Tennessee Valley Authority runs its operations from a downtown tower. Just to the west, Oak Ridge remains a national hub for scientific research, home to Oak Ridge National Laboratory and the Y-12 National Security Complex — a concentration of physics, computing and energy expertise that traces back to the Manhattan Project and still draws engineers and scientists from around the world.

Manufacturing, Tourism and the Outdoors

South of the city, Blount County builds things — aluminum in Alcoa and a spread of automotive and aerospace suppliers across the region. To the southeast, the Sevier County towns of Gatlinburg, Pigeon Forge and Sevierville form the northern gateway to Great Smoky Mountains National Park, the most visited national park in the United States, and a tourism economy of resorts, attractions and Dollywood that runs year-round.

Add the outdoor recreation of the foothills and the rivers, and the 865 region becomes a place where a local number genuinely signals you belong to the community.

865 vs 423: Choosing an East Tennessee Number

Unlike an overlay, where two codes share the same ground, 865 and 423 divide East Tennessee between them. 865 is the Knoxville-area code, while 423 covers the rest of the eastern third of the state — Chattanooga in the south and the Tri-Cities of Kingsport, Johnson City and Bristol in the northeast.

They are neighbors on the map rather than layers on top of each other, so the choice between them is really a choice of which part of East Tennessee a number should signal.

  • 865 — the Knoxville metro, Oak Ridge, Blount County and the Smokies gateway towns; the code that spells VOL
  • 423 — Chattanooga, the Tri-Cities and the rest of East Tennessee outside the Knoxville region
  • Both sit in the Eastern Time zone, and neither carries an overlay, so single-code dialing still works within each region

For a business, an 865 number is the natural choice for a Knoxville-area presence, carrying both the local recognition of the metro and the well-known VOL association. A 423 number reads as Chattanooga or Tri-Cities instead. Either can be activated as a cloud number regardless of where a team actually works, so the decision comes down to which East Tennessee market a company most wants to feel local to.

Common 865 Phone Scams to Watch For

865 is a legitimate, long-established East Tennessee code, but like any area code its numbers can be spoofed. Caller-ID spoofing lets a fraudster make any number — including an 865 prefix — appear on a screen, so a resident sees what looks like a nearby Knoxville business, bank or agency calling.

A local-looking 865 caller ID can be spoofed — verify unknown callers and never share details under pressure

The prefix itself proves nothing: a genuine 865 call and a spoofed one look identical, and scammers deliberately choose a familiar local code because people are more likely to answer it.

  • Fake bank or payment alerts — a voicemail or text about a 'suspicious transaction' pushing you to call back or tap a link
  • Prize and refund lures — claims you have won something or are owed a refund, requesting card details to 'process' it
  • Utility and delivery threats — messages that your power will be cut or a package held unless you pay a small fee immediately

The reliable defense is to hang up and call back through a number you find independently — on a bill, an official website or a saved contact. No genuine bank, utility or government agency demands gift cards or wire transfers over the phone, and a local-looking 865 caller ID is never proof of who is really on the line.
